TSMG is seeking a Self-Driving Systems Specialist to support diagnostics, calibration, configuration, and readiness of autonomous vehicle systems across Europe, including deployment in London. You will work with engineering and operations teams to diagnose issues, validate hardware and software, and ensure fleet readiness for robotaxi operations.

Ideal candidates have 3+ years in automotive electronics, diagnostics, or robotics, with fluent English and strong structured problem-solving.
